Apple Cinnamon Baked Oatmeal: A Nutritious Breakfast

Apple Cinnamon Baked Oatmeal

This apple cinnamon baked oatmeal is a hearty, wholesome breakfast option that transforms pantry staples into a comforting meal. Featuring fresh apples, protein-packed Greek yogurt, and nutrient-dense hemp hearts, this dish offers a balanced start to your day. It is naturally moist, fiber-rich, and perfect for meal prepping throughout the week.

  • Total Time: 65
  • Yield: 9 servings

Ingredients

Scale

2/3 cup unsweetened apple sauce
1 cup egg whites
1 cup Greek yogurt
1 cup milk
2 Tbsp maple syrup
2 tsp vanilla extract
3 cups quick oats
1/2 cup hemp hearts
2.5 tsp cinnamon
1 tsp salt
2 tsp baking powder
1 tsp baking soda
3 cups apples, chopped
1/2 cup pecans, toasted
2 Tbsp brown sugar

Instructions

Preheat the oven to 375°F (175°C) and line a 9×13-inch baking dish with parchment paper.
Combine apple sauce, egg whites, Greek yogurt, milk, maple syrup, and vanilla in a large bowl.
Fold in the oats, hemp hearts, 2 teaspoons of cinnamon, salt, baking powder, baking soda, and 2 cups of the chopped apples.
Pour the mixture into the prepared baking dish.
Top with the remaining 1 cup of apples, toasted pecans, and a sprinkle of brown sugar and the remaining 0.5 teaspoon of cinnamon.
Bake for 50 minutes until golden and firm in the center.
Allow to cool slightly before slicing and serving.

Notes

Use gluten-free oats if you have dietary sensitivities.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. Reheat individual portions in the microwave or oven.
